Transaction 986aa7610abfc9560a45f81dd1d8ff1239e0521bcb25770020c668ebe51e5460

2 Input
2 Outputs
  • 986aa7610abfc9560a45f81dd1d8ff1239e0521bcb25770020c668ebe51e5460:0
  • value  1154935
    address  3FjorVMDUWXhc33PeECzNbyDYWqgkJ9ExX
  • 986aa7610abfc9560a45f81dd1d8ff1239e0521bcb25770020c668ebe51e5460:1
  • value  966138
    address  19W2uuHZaAb7tc3Ca27onSoTX6oT8Ch5sf